Composition and responsibilities of the pit crew members
A typical Formula 1 pit crew consists of several members, each with a specific role to play during a pit stop. These roles include:
- The front jack operator: Responsible for lifting the front of the car using a hydraulic jack to allow tire changes.
- The rear jack operator: Performs the same function as the front jack operator, lifting the rear of the car.
- The tire changers: Two members tasked with quickly removing and replacing the tires on both sides of the car.
- The tire carriers: Two individuals responsible for carrying the new tires and handing them to the tire changers.
- The fueler: Connects the fuel hose to the car and ensures a safe and efficient refueling process.
- The fire extinguisher operator: Stands ready with a fire extinguisher in case of any fuel-related accidents.
- The lollipop or traffic light holder: Displays a signal to the driver indicating when it is safe to leave the pit box.
- The data engineer: Monitors and records vital information about the car’s performance during the pit stop.

A. Impact of tire performance on overall race strategy
Tire changes play a crucial role in a Formula 1 race, as the performance of the tires directly affects the overall strategy of the teams. The tires are the only point of contact between the car and the track, making their condition a determining factor in the car’s speed, grip, and overall handling.
Throughout a race, the tires undergo massive amounts of wear and degradation due to the high speeds and forces they are subjected to. As the tires wear down, their performance decreases, resulting in decreased lap times and reduced grip. Therefore, a well-timed tire change can significantly impact a team’s chances of success.
Teams carefully analyze tire performance data during practice sessions and qualifying rounds to determine the optimal time to change tires during the race. Factors such as track temperature, tire compounds, and the duration of the race all play a role in this decision-making process. A premature tire change can lead to unnecessary pit stops and wasted time, while delaying a tire change risks compromising the car’s performance, losing valuable time, and, ultimately, losing positions on the track.
B. Different tire compounds and their suitability for various track conditions
Formula 1 races feature different tire compounds, each designed to perform optimally under specific track conditions. The tire compounds can range from soft to medium to hard, with each offering different levels of grip, durability, and performance characteristics.
The choice of tire compound is crucial in determining a team’s strategy during a race. Soft compounds provide greater grip, allowing for higher speeds and better performance during the early stages of a race or on a track with less abrasive surfaces. However, they wear down quickly and require more frequent changes. On the other hand, hard compounds provide durability but sacrifice grip.
Teams must carefully assess track conditions, weather forecasts, and their car’s performance to select the most suitable tire compound for a particular race. Factors such as ambient temperature, track temperature, and track surface conditions need to be considered to maximize the tire’s performance and ensure an effective race strategy.

Pit Stop Strategy in Formula 1
A. Importance of optimal timing for pit stops
In the high-octane world of Formula 1, pit stops play a crucial role in determining the outcome of races. One of the key elements in pit stop strategies is the timing of when to make a pit stop. Pit stops are not just about changing tires and refueling; they are strategic decisions that can make or break a driver’s chances of victory.
Timing is of the essence when it comes to pit stops in Formula 1. The teams and drivers must carefully assess variables like tire degradation, track conditions, and fuel levels to determine the optimal moment to visit the pit lane. Making a pit stop too early can result in a loss of track position, while delaying a pit stop too long can lead to tire wear or running out of fuel.
The choice of the ideal moment to make a pit stop depends on several factors. Firstly, tire degradation is a crucial element to consider. As tires wear out over the course of a race, their performance deteriorates, leading to decreased grip and slower lap times. To maximize performance, teams aim to perform pit stops just before the tires reach their limit, ensuring the driver has fresh rubber for the remainder of the race.
Secondly, track conditions can significantly impact pit stop strategy. If the track is damp or rain is expected, teams may opt for an early pit stop to switch to wet or intermediate tires. Conversely, in dry conditions, teams may push the limits of tire life to gain a competitive advantage, delaying the pit stop as long as possible.
Lastly, fuel levels play a crucial role in pit stop strategy. Carrying excessive fuel can slow down lap times, so teams aim to minimize fuel load while still ensuring the driver can complete the required number of laps. Balancing fuel efficiency, tire management, and track conditions is a delicate task for teams and requires strategic decision-making.
B. Factors influencing pit stop strategy decisions
Several factors influence the decisions regarding pit stop strategies in Formula 1. Firstly, the positions of other competitors on the track play a crucial role. If a driver is stuck behind slower cars, making an early pit stop can provide an opportunity to gain track position and overtake rivals who have yet to stop. On the other hand, if a driver is leading the race comfortably, they may choose to delay their pit stop to maintain their advantage.
Additionally, race-specific circumstances can also influence pit stop strategies. Safety car deployments, which slow down the race due to accidents or track hazards, present an opportunity for drivers to make pit stops without losing significant time. The reduced race pace under a safety car allows teams to make pit stops without losing as much track position, making it an opportune moment to take advantage of.
Furthermore, the overall race strategy and objectives of the team can shape pit stop decisions. Some teams may opt for a one-stop strategy, aiming to make only a single pit stop throughout the race. This approach requires careful tire management and fuel conservation but can provide a strategic advantage if executed successfully. Other teams may choose a more aggressive two or three-stop strategy, sacrificing track position for fresher tires and faster lap times.
